TAIHAPE STOCK SALE.
Dalgaty and Co., Ltd., Palmerston North, report having held their usual fortnightly sale at Taihape on Wednesday last, when a, fair yarding of sheep and cattle came forward. All stock were dull of sale, and prices showed a marked decrease, there being practically no demand. Quotations: — Sheep: Mixed aged ewes 10s 6d to 14s; mixed 2-ths los Id: small 2-tobths 13s 6d; fat and forward ewes 25s 4cl ; cull mixed lambs 2s lid; 2-th empty ewes (very small) 5s 8d to 9s. Cattle : 20-month steers £3 Is to £5; 20-months heifers £3 2s to £4 8s .
